Narrative Opinion Summary

The Supreme Court of Pennsylvania, Middle District, has denied the Petition for Allowance of Appeal filed by Jerry Reeves (Petitioner) in case No. 220 MAL 2022 against the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ania (Respondent). Additionally, the court has granted the application from the Innocence Network and the Innocence Project to file an Amici Curiae Brief. The order was issued per curiam on September 7, 2022.
